@stasykk

Парсинг не формирует файл csv?

Доброго всем времени суток!

Вот написала по уроку код парсинга авито: https://pastebin.com/CDM3fX8W

В результате парсинг не создает файл csv, при этом никаких ошибок не показывает.
Единственное различие между мной и автором урока - это операционная система, у автора linux, у меня windows. Я уже в процессе установки на другом железе системы linux, чтобы убедиться, что файл у меня рабочий, уж очень жаль в пустую потраченное время, но может кто знает решения проблемы без столь долгих манипуляций?
  • Вопрос задан
  • 304 просмотра
Решения вопроса 1
в вашем коде три ошибки:

1) в конце у вас блок if _name_ == '__main__' попал в функцию, а должен быть сам по себе
2) if _name_ == '__main__' неправильно написана переменная. Не _name_ с одинарными подчёркиваниями а с двойными. Вот так: __name__
3) в блоке кода
if _name_ == '__main__':
  main()

вы пытаетесь вызвать функцию main(). А определена функция mail()

П.С.
Ещё в коде написаны блоки try - except без определения типа ошибки, это значит что эти участки кода будут молча пропускаться, и невозможно будет понять почему этот код не сработал.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
deeplay Новосибирск
от 130 000 ₽
Enjoy PRO Санкт-Петербург
от 140 000 до 180 000 ₽
от 130 000 ₽
23 окт. 2020, в 03:00
1500 руб./за проект
23 окт. 2020, в 01:21
600 руб./за проект